  • Save The Date

    June 21st, 2008 by Connie Roberts

    wedding party

    Oh my gosh! It’s getting too real for me. We’re talking budgets, wedding dresses, bridesmaids, to have a DJ or not (not) and so much more because there is so much more. As for now the date is August 1, 2009 for Lady Ali’s wedding.

    August 1, 2009 will be my Mom’s 80th birthday. At first Lady Ali didn’t think she should have her wedding on that day but I think it would be a very nice tribute to her Grammy. It fits into her and Fiance’s schedule so why not?

    They’re planning on a casual brunch reception but family is very important to both of them. There won’t be the “tacky” traditions as they call them, like the garter belt, but there will be family dances and lots of photos.

    I was pleasantly pleased when Lady Ali asked me and Hubby what we wanted at the wedding. She is really showing her maturity. She was shocked when we said we’d pay for the wedding so she’s being very thoughtful. Well she’s thoughtful any way, but even more so now.

    It’s fun talking about the wedding plans. I’m just getting a bit worried like any Mom would. I trust her though. I really like Fiance too. I wish we had more time to get to know him before they moved. I’ll try to go to Kansas as soon as I’m feeling better to visit them for a long weekend.
